has any of you used fade creams? they have a lot of those in cvs. I just bought Esoterica Fade Cream and started using it. I tried to look it up but I could not find much information on it. any experiences to share? did it work for you? most of them have hydroquinone as an active ingridient.
 
I have used Esoterica in the past and honestly the smell was a little overwhelming. The best I have found so far is Palmers Skin Success Fade Cream. It also has hydroquinone (the active ingredient) and the smell is obsoltete.

These actually do fade hyperpigmented areas on your body, but make sure to only apply to the effected area. If you don't, you could end up with blotchy-ness.
